Traeger, Inc.

Traeger, Inc. designs and sells wood pellet grills and related outdoor cooking products under the Traeger brand. The company also offers consumables such as wood pellets, rubs, sauces, and accessories, and sells through retail partners and direct-to-consumer channels in North America and selected international markets.

Wood pellet grills55% Outdoor cooking systems that grill, smoke, bake, roast, braise, and barbecue with hardwood pellets.
Consumables20% Recurring-use products including wood pellets, rubs, sauces, and seasonings.
Accessories15% Add-on products such as grill accessories and smart thermometers, including MEATER.
Direct-to-consumer and digital10% Sales and engagement through Traeger.com, the Traeger app, and digital content.

  • Substantially all revenue comes from North America
  • Core markets are the United States and Canada
  • Selected European markets are served through local distribution models
  • Third-party logistics operate in the U.S., Netherlands, U.K., Germany, and Canada
  • Geography matters because imports, tariffs, and shipping affect supply and margins
